Commit Message

Khem Raj March 8, 2017, 6:40 a.m. UTC
* This is converging the recipes for go from
  meta-virtualization and oe-meta-go

* Add recipes for go 1.7

* go.bbclass is added to ease out writing
  recipes for go packages

* go-examples: Add an example, helloworld written in go
  This should serve as temlate for writing go recipes

* Disable for musl, at least for now

* Disable for x32/ppc32 which is not supported

This is looking pretty good now.  I built go & go-helloworld easily
with no warnings, etc.  'go-helloworld' runs fine on my target.

However, there don't seem to be any packages for the target created
by the 'go' recipe:

$ ls tmp/work/cortexa9hf-neon-amltd-linux-gnueabi/go/1.8-r0
armhf-elf-header.patch         go               pseudo                             syslog.patch
build-tmp                      gotooldir.patch  recipe-sysroot                     sysroot-destdir
fix-cc-handling.patch          image            recipe-sysroot-native              temp
fix-target-cc-for-build.patch  license-destdir  split-host-and-target-build.patch

I manually copied the 'image' directory (which obviously has a lot
of stuff not designed to be on my target board) to my target and
'go' seems to run there.

There is a need for RRECOMMENDS = "git-perltools" once this packaging is set:

~# go get golang.org/x/tour/gotour
go: missing Git command. See https://golang.org/s/gogetcmd
package golang.org/x/tour/gotour: exec: "git": executable file not found in $PATH

I ran through the tour (above) and things seemed to go well.

All in all, looking better.

diff --git a/meta/classes/go.bbclass b/meta/classes/go.bbclass
new file mode 100644
index 0000000000..f1984604b0
--- /dev/null
+++ b/meta/classes/go.bbclass
@@ -0,0 +1,79 @@ 
+inherit goarch
+
+# Incompatible with musl, at least for now
+COMPATIBLE_HOST_libc-musl_class-target = "null"
+# x32 ABI is not supported on go compiler so far
+COMPATIBLE_HOST_linux-gnux32 = "null"
+# ppc32 is not supported in go compilers
+COMPATIBLE_HOST_powerpc = "null"
+
+GOROOT_class-native = "${STAGING_LIBDIR_NATIVE}/go"
+GOROOT = "${STAGING_LIBDIR_NATIVE}/${TARGET_SYS}/go"
+GOBIN_FINAL_class-native = "${GOROOT_FINAL}/bin"
+GOBIN_FINAL = "${GOROOT_FINAL}/bin/${GOOS}_${GOARCH}"
+
+export GOOS = "${TARGET_GOOS}"
+export GOARCH = "${TARGET_GOARCH}"
+export GOARM = "${TARGET_GOARM}"
+export CGO_ENABLED = "1"
+export GOROOT
+export GOROOT_FINAL = "${libdir}/${TARGET_SYS}/go"
+export GOBIN_FINAL
+export GOPKG_FINAL = "${GOROOT_FINAL}/pkg/${GOOS}_${GOARCH}"
+export GOSRC_FINAL = "${GOROOT_FINAL}/src"
+export GO_GCFLAGS = "${TARGET_CFLAGS}"
+export GO_LDFLAGS = "${TARGET_LDFLAGS}"
+export CGO_CFLAGS = "${TARGET_CC_ARCH}${TOOLCHAIN_OPTIONS} ${TARGET_CFLAGS}"
+export CGO_CPPFLAGS = "${TARGET_CPPFLAGS}"
+export CGO_CXXFLAGS = "${TARGET_CC_ARCH}${TOOLCHAIN_OPTIONS} ${TARGET_CXXFLAGS}"
+export CGO_LDFLAGS = "${TARGET_CC_ARCH}${TOOLCHAIN_OPTIONS} ${TARGET_LDFLAGS}"
+
+DEPENDS += "go-cross-${TARGET_ARCH}"
+DEPENDS_class-native += "go-native"
+
+FILES_${PN}-staticdev += "${GOSRC_FINAL}/${GO_IMPORT}"
+FILES_${PN}-staticdev += "${GOPKG_FINAL}/${GO_IMPORT}*"
+
+GO_INSTALL ?= "${GO_IMPORT}/..."
+
+do_go_compile() {
+	GOPATH=${S}:${STAGING_LIBDIR}/${TARGET_SYS}/go go env
+	if test -n "${GO_INSTALL}" ; then
+		GOPATH=${S}:${STAGING_LIBDIR}/${TARGET_SYS}/go go install -v ${GO_INSTALL}
+	fi
+}
+
+do_go_install() {
+	rm -rf ${WORKDIR}/staging
+	install -d ${WORKDIR}/staging${GOROOT_FINAL} ${D}${GOROOT_FINAL}
+	tar -C ${S} -cf - . | tar -C ${WORKDIR}/staging${GOROOT_FINAL} -xpvf -
+
+	find ${WORKDIR}/staging${GOROOT_FINAL} \( \
+		-name \*.indirectionsymlink -o \
+		-name .git\* -o                \
+		-name .hg -o                   \
+		-name .svn -o                  \
+		-name .pc\* -o                 \
+		-name patches\*                \
+		\) -print0 | \
+	xargs -r0 rm -rf
+
+	tar -C ${WORKDIR}/staging${GOROOT_FINAL} -cf - . | \
+	tar -C ${D}${GOROOT_FINAL} -xpvf -
+
+	chown -R root:root "${D}${GOROOT_FINAL}"
+
+	if test -e "${D}${GOBIN_FINAL}" ; then
+		install -d -m 0755 "${D}${bindir}"
+		find "${D}${GOBIN_FINAL}" ! -type d -print0 | xargs -r0 mv --target-directory="${D}${bindir}"
+		rmdir -p "${D}${GOBIN_FINAL}" || true
+	fi
+}
+
+do_compile() {
+	do_go_compile
+}
+
+do_install() {
+	do_go_install
+}
diff --git a/meta/classes/goarch.bbclass b/meta/classes/goarch.bbclass
new file mode 100644
index 0000000000..4a5b2ec787
--- /dev/null
+++ b/meta/classes/goarch.bbclass
@@ -0,0 +1,50 @@ 
+BUILD_GOOS = "${@go_map_os(d.getVar('BUILD_OS', True), d)}"
+BUILD_GOARCH = "${@go_map_arch(d.getVar('BUILD_ARCH', True), d)}"
+BUILD_GOTUPLE = "${BUILD_GOOS}_${BUILD_GOARCH}"
+HOST_GOOS = "${@go_map_os(d.getVar('HOST_OS', True), d)}"
+HOST_GOARCH = "${@go_map_arch(d.getVar('HOST_ARCH', True), d)}"
+HOST_GOARM = "${@go_map_arm(d.getVar('HOST_ARCH', True), d.getVar('TUNE_FEATURES', True), d)}"
+HOST_GOTUPLE = "${HOST_GOOS}_${HOST_GOARCH}"
+TARGET_GOOS = "${@go_map_os(d.getVar('TARGET_OS', True), d)}"
+TARGET_GOARCH = "${@go_map_arch(d.getVar('TARGET_ARCH', True), d)}"
+TARGET_GOARM = "${@go_map_arm(d.getVar('TARGET_ARCH', True), d.getVar('TUNE_FEATURES', True), d)}"
+TARGET_GOTUPLE = "${TARGET_GOOS}_${TARGET_GOARCH}"
+GO_BUILD_BINDIR = "${@['bin/${HOST_GOTUPLE}','bin'][d.getVar('BUILD_GOTUPLE',True) == d.getVar('HOST_GOTUPLE',True)]}"
+
+def go_map_arch(a, d):
+    import re
+    if re.match('i.86', a):
+        return '386'
+    elif a == 'x86_64':
+        return 'amd64'
+    elif re.match('arm.*', a):
+        return 'arm'
+    elif re.match('aarch64.*', a):
+        return 'arm64'
+    elif re.match('mips64el*', a):
+        return 'mips64le'
+    elif re.match('mips64*', a):
+        return 'mips64'
+    elif re.match('mipsel*', a):
+        return 'mipsle'
+    elif re.match('mips*', a):
+        return 'mips'
+    elif re.match('p(pc|owerpc)(64)', a):
+        return 'ppc64'
+    elif re.match('p(pc|owerpc)(64el)', a):
+        return 'ppc64le'
+    else:
+        raise bb.parse.SkipPackage("Unsupported CPU architecture: %s" % a)
+
+def go_map_arm(a, f, d):
+    import re
+    if re.match('arm.*', a) and re.match('arm.*7.*', f):
+        return '7'
+    return ''
+
+def go_map_os(o, d):
+    if o.startswith('linux'):
+        return 'linux'
+    return o
+

diff --git a/meta/recipes-devtools/go/go-1.4/go-cross-backport-cmd-link-support-new-386-amd64-rel.patch b/meta/recipes-devtools/go/go-1.4/go-cross-backport-cmd-link-support-new-386-amd64-rel.patch
new file mode 100644
index 0000000000..95ca9d3aa9
--- /dev/null
+++ b/meta/recipes-devtools/go/go-1.4/go-cross-backport-cmd-link-support-new-386-amd64-rel.patch
@@ -0,0 +1,225 @@ 
+From d6eefad445831c161fca130f9bdf7b3848aac23c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001
+From: Paul Gortmaker <paul.gortmaker@windriver.com>
+Date: Tue, 29 Mar 2016 21:14:33 -0400
+Subject: [PATCH] go-cross: backport "cmd/link: support new 386/amd64
+ relocations"
+
+Newer binutils won't support building older go-1.4.3 as per:
+
+https://github.com/golang/go/issues/13114
+
+Upstream commit 914db9f060b1fd3eb1f74d48f3bd46a73d4ae9c7 (see subj)
+was identified as the fix and nominated for 1.4.4 but that release
+never happened.  The paths in 1.4.3 aren't the same as go1.6beta1~662
+where this commit appeared, but the NetBSD folks indicated what a
+1.4.3 backport would look like here: https://gnats.netbsd.org/50777
+
+This is based on that, but without the BSD wrapper infrastructure
+layer that makes things look like patches of patches.
+
+Signed-off-by: Paul Gortmaker <paul.gortmaker@windriver.com>
+
+Upstream-Status: Backport [ Partial ]
+

diff --git a/meta/recipes-devtools/go/go-1.6/split-host-and-target-build.patch b/meta/recipes-devtools/go/go-1.6/split-host-and-target-build.patch
new file mode 100644
index 0000000000..afbae02b4e
--- /dev/null
+++ b/meta/recipes-devtools/go/go-1.6/split-host-and-target-build.patch
@@ -0,0 +1,63 @@ 
+Add new option --target-only to build target components
+Separates the host and target pieces of build
+
+Signed-off-by: Khem Raj <raj.khem@gmail.com>
+Upstream-Status: Pending
+Index: go/src/make.bash
+===================================================================
+--- go.orig/src/make.bash
++++ go/src/make.bash
+@@ -143,12 +143,23 @@ if [ "$1" = "--no-clean" ]; then
+ 	buildall=""
+ 	shift
+ fi
+-./cmd/dist/dist bootstrap $buildall $GO_DISTFLAGS -v # builds go_bootstrap
+-# Delay move of dist tool to now, because bootstrap may clear tool directory.
+-mv cmd/dist/dist "$GOTOOLDIR"/dist
+-echo
+ 
+-if [ "$GOHOSTARCH" != "$GOARCH" -o "$GOHOSTOS" != "$GOOS" ]; then
++do_host_build="yes"
++do_target_build="yes"
++if [ "$1" = "--target-only" ]; then
++	do_host_build="no"
++	shift
++elif [ "$1" = "--host-only" ]; then
++	do_target_build="no"
++	shift
++fi
++
++if [ "$do_host_build" = "yes" ]; then
++	./cmd/dist/dist bootstrap $buildall $GO_DISTFLAGS -v # builds go_bootstrap
++	# Delay move of dist tool to now, because bootstrap may clear tool directory.
++	mv cmd/dist/dist "$GOTOOLDIR"/dist
++	echo
++
+ 	echo "##### Building packages and commands for host, $GOHOSTOS/$GOHOSTARCH."
+ 	# CC_FOR_TARGET is recorded as the default compiler for the go tool. When building for the host, however,
+ 	# use the host compiler, CC, from `cmd/dist/dist env` instead.
+@@ -157,11 +168,20 @@ if [ "$GOHOSTARCH" != "$GOARCH" -o "$GOH
+ 	echo
+ fi
+ 
+-echo "##### Building packages and commands for $GOOS/$GOARCH."
+-CC="$CC_FOR_TARGET" "$GOTOOLDIR"/go_bootstrap install $GO_FLAGS -gcflags "$GO_GCFLAGS" -ldflags "$GO_LDFLAGS" -v std cmd
+-echo
++if [ "$do_target_build" = "yes" ]; then
++    GO_INSTALL="${GO_TARGET_INSTALL:-std cmd}"
++    echo "##### Building packages and commands for $GOOS/$GOARCH."
++    if [ "$GOHOSTOS" = "$GOOS" -a "$GOHOSTARCH" = "$GOARCH" -a "$do_host_build" = "yes" ]; then
++	rm -rf ./host-tools
++	mkdir ./host-tools
++	mv "$GOTOOLDIR"/* ./host-tools
++	GOTOOLDIR="$PWD/host-tools"
++    fi
++    GOTOOLDIR="$GOTOOLDIR" CC="$CC_FOR_TARGET" "$GOTOOLDIR"/go_bootstrap install $GO_FLAGS -gcflags "$GO_GCFLAGS" -ldflags "$GO_LDFLAGS" -v ${GO_INSTALL}
++    echo
+ 
+-rm -f "$GOTOOLDIR"/go_bootstrap
++    rm -f "$GOTOOLDIR"/go_bootstrap
++fi
+ 
+ if [ "$1" != "--no-banner" ]; then
+ 	"$GOTOOLDIR"/dist banner
